diff --git a/Python/Bubble_sort.py b/Python/Bubble_sort.py new file mode 100644 index 0000000..6f55280 --- /dev/null +++ b/Python/Bubble_sort.py @@ -0,0 +1,26 @@ +def bubbleSort(arr): + n = len(arr) + swapped = False + + for i in range(n-1): + + for j in range(0, n-i-1): + + + if arr[j] > arr[j + 1]: + swapped = True + arr[j], arr[j + 1] = arr[j + 1], arr[j] + + if not swapped: + + return + + + +arr = [64, 34, 25, 12, 22, 11, 90] + +bubbleSort(arr) + +print("Sorted array is:") +for i in range(len(arr)): + print("% d" % arr[i], end=" ")